BRAZE ranks #8024 of 9,347 employers tracked on the layoffhedge H-1B Explorer, with 80 LCA filings from FY2015 through FY2026. The median reported wage across its filings is $150,000. Its largest state footprint is New York with 48 filings, led by New York, NY. The most common job title on its filings is Software Developers.

Source and method. U.S. Department of Labor, Labor Condition Application (LCA) disclosure files, FY2015 through FY2026. Each certified LCA filing counts once, regardless of how many worker positions it covers. FY2026 includes Q1 only (October to December 2025). Median wage is the median of reported LCA wages for this employer. An LCA is a required first step of the H-1B process and does not by itself mean a visa was issued.
